How does the cost of private client services in the cryptocurrency sector compare to traditional banking?
What are the differences in cost between private client services in the cryptocurrency sector and traditional banking?
7 answers
- Lundgren JacobsenNov 21, 2022 · 4 years agoThe cost of private client services in the cryptocurrency sector can vary significantly compared to traditional banking. In the cryptocurrency sector, there are often lower fees associated with transactions and account maintenance due to the decentralized nature of cryptocurrencies. However, additional costs may arise from the need for specialized security measures and the volatility of cryptocurrency prices. Traditional banking, on the other hand, typically involves higher fees for services such as wire transfers, foreign exchange, and account maintenance. It is important for individuals to carefully consider their specific needs and compare the costs and benefits of both options before making a decision.
